Historically 26% of students fail MATH2124. Assume that the current class of 175 students forms a random sample.
What is the expected number of students who fail and the variance of the number of students who fail?
Your answers can be rounded to four decimal digit accuracy when entered.

E(fail) =
Var(fail) =
